Upon arrival in Sri Lanka, you will be welcomed by a representative of Lanka Sportreizen and transferred to your hotel in Negombo. After check-in, take some time to relax. Later, explore Negombo on a city tour visiting a traditional fishing village, the Old Dutch Fortress from 1678 (later converted to a prison), the historic Hamilton Canal built by the Dutch for cinnamon transportation, the Old Dutch Cemetery, and the lively Negombo Fish Market, providing a glimpse of local life and culture.
After breakfast, depart for Kalpitiya. En route, visit the Munneswaram Hindu Temple, a site famous in the Indian epic Ramayana. Continue to Kalpitiya and explore Talawila St. Anne’s Church, the Fisheries Harbour, and a traditional fishing village. Witness the diverse vegetation of the region including agricultural farmlands, salterns, mangroves, and coconut plantations.
After breakfast, depart for Anuradhapura, the first capital of Sri Lanka dating back to the 5th century BC. Explore the city’s archaeological and historical highlights including Isurumuniya Temple, the sacred Sri Maha Bodhi Tree (over 2,300 years old), Ruwanweliseya Stupa, Jethawanaramaya, Abhayagiriya, Thuparamaya, and the Samadhi Statue. These ancient monuments showcase Sri Lanka’s Buddhist heritage and some have been recognized as UNESCO World Heritage Sites.
After breakfast, travel to Passikudah, stopping at Polonnaruwa, the medieval capital of Sri Lanka (11th century AD). Explore its sacred city, visiting the Quadrangle, Royal Palace, Vatadage, Hatadage, Siva Devalaya, Gal Viharaya, Alahana Pirivena Complex, Lotus and Kumara Ponds, Thuparamaya, Rankoth Vehera, Pabalu Vehera, Thivanka Image House, and the museum. Many of these sites reflect the Hindu influence on Buddhist civilization. Continue to Passikudah for an overnight stay.
After breakfast, enjoy a relaxing day at Passikudah. Spend the day at leisure exploring the pristine beach, soaking up the sun, or enjoying water activities.
After breakfast, depart for Kandy, traveling via the scenic 18 Hair-Pin Bends. En route, visit the Maha Oya Hot Springs, the hottest hot spring in Sri Lanka, with seven wells of varying temperatures. Upon arrival in Kandy, attend a cultural show featuring traditional Kandyan dancers, drummers, and a devotional fire-walking ceremony. Visit the sacred Temple of the Tooth Relic, one of the most important Buddhist pilgrimage sites in the world.
After breakfast, explore Kandy with a city tour including the Upper Lake Drive for panoramic views of the city and a visit to a Gem Museum to witness how precious gems are crafted from raw stones. After the tour, continue your journey back to Negombo for the evening.
After breakfast, check out from your hotel and transfer to the airport for your onward departure, concluding your memorable Sri Lankan journey.
